66C8685 FOR LIUGONG FORKLIFT 66C8685 FOR LIUGONG FORKLIFT SKU: 66C8685 Category: FORKLIFT PARTS Tag: 66C8685 Description Description 66C8685 FOR LIUGONG FORKLIFT Related products SP129368 FOR LIUGONG FORKLIFT Read more 10C2952 FOR LIUGONG FORKLIFT Read more SP109853 ENGINE FAN FOR LIUGONG FORKLIFT Read more 08B0450 FOR LIUGONG FORKLIFT Read more